About The Position

As an integral part of the Health Center Management Team, the Patient Services Manager manages and supervises all aspects of the assigned center’s family planning/abortion program and/or colposcopy & sterilization program as applicable to the assigned center. This includes the daily operational functions of assuring adequate supply, equipment, and staffing levels for cost efficient and Patient-centered delivery of services and the on-going goals of high productivity and quality assurance. This position is supervised by the Center Director.

Responsibilities

  • Directly manage and oversee the family planning and abortion program at the assigned center.
  • May also manage and oversee colposcopy and/or sterilization programs, depending on the assigned location.
  • Supervise the productivity, efficiency, quality assurance and adherence to protocols of assigned health care service. Monitor appointment schedules for efficiency for maximize patient volume or meeting patients’ projections.
  • Ensure services are provided in a patient-centered manner and enhancing the patient experience.
  • Responsible for program management including audits, statistical reports and maintenance of manuals.
  • Build a cohesive team by recruiting, hiring, training, supervising, evaluating and developing the non-licensed health center staff for assigned programs.
  • Handle communication problems with other staff and managers directly, constructively and with sensitivity.
  • Assist Regional/Center Director with ensuring productivity and quality assurance of clinical services.
  • Assist the Regional/Center Director with program development and all daily functions of the assigned center.
  • Assist the Regional/Center Director with the daily functions of the assigned center including working in both family planning and specialty services.
  • Provide direct-patient care approximately 40% of the time, while working side-by-side clinical staff.
  • Participate as a team member with other program managers and coordinators.
  • Attend affiliate-wide meetings as indicated.
  • Role-models and provides Leadership toward the implementation of PPNorCal’s Diversity, Equity, and Inclusion plan
